* The Integrated Weapons Experiments Division (J Division), J-6 Group, is seeking a highly motivated graduate student to support experimental operations and engineering activities at the Dual-Axis Radiographic Hydrodynamic Test (DARHT) Facility. This position provides an opportunity to contribute to the operation, maintenance, and continuous improvement of one of the world's premier high-energy radiographic facilities supporting the Laboratory's national security mission.
The selected candidate will work alongside a multidisciplinary team of engineers, physicists, and technicians responsible for the operation and sustainment of DARHT's pulsed power and accelerator systems. Research and engineering activities may include pulsed power systems, high-voltage engineering, power distribution, electrical diagnostics, instrumentation and controls, system performance analysis, reliability improvements, and experimental support for facility operations.
Working under the guidance of experienced technical staff, the graduate student will assist with electrical engineering analyses, support testing and commissioning activities, evaluate system performance, analyze experimental and operational data, develop engineering models and documentation, and contribute to projects that improve the reliability, safety, and performance of DARHT's accelerator and pulsed power systems.
